Our social constructs of the concept of lesbianism are impacted by a number of factors. One of the more insidious of these factors is the media. To some degree, our contemporary ideas of lesbianism are constructed in, by, and through media representations. Film portrayals of lesbianism document the evolution that has occurred in regard to depictions of lesbianism.
One has only to look to the cinema to observe how our societal perception of lesbianism has gradually changed. In the 1930's, for example, lesbianism was only hinted at in films like "Maedchen in Uniform (Girls in Uniform)" and "Morocco". Event those hints, however, resulted in significant societal rebuff.
